§ 28-1-107 — Definitions

(a)As used in this act:
(i)"Committee" means any duly constituted committee of the legislature, any standing committee of either house of the legislature, joint interim committee of the legislature, special investigating committee established by joint resolution of the legislature and the committees established by W.S. 28-11-101, 28-11-201 and 28-11-301;
(ii)"Council" means the management council of the legislature;
(iii)"Legislature" means the Wyoming legislature;
(iv)"Subpoena" means a legislative subpoena or subpoena duces tecum in such form and issued pursuant to rules prescribed by the legislature or council;
(v)"This act" means W.S. 28-1-107 through 28-1-112 and any future amendments thereto.
